A kilonewton is a unit used to measure force. The kilonewton is a multiple of the newton, which is the SI derived unit for force. In the metric system, "kilo" is the prefix for thousands, or 103. Kilonewtons can be abbreviated as kN; for example, 1 kilonewton can be written as...

A meganewton is a unit used to measureforce. The meganewton is a multiple of thenewton, which is theSIderived unit for force. In the metric system, "mega" is the prefix for millions, or 106. Meganewtons can be abbreviated asMN; for example, 1 meganewton can be written as 1 MN. ...
